Madison Connections

UW-Fond du Lac partners with UW-Madison on a Madison Connections program. The University of Wisconsin-Madison educates thousands of the state's citizens every year by admitting some of the best and brightest students from throughout Wisconsin.

Unfortunately, UW-Madison cannot accommadate all of the academically strong students who apply for admission. The Connections program offers select applicants, who are Wisconsin residents, the opportunity to start at a partner college or university and finish their bachelor's degree at UW-Madison--and hold a distinctive UW-Madison student status from the beginning.

UW-Fond du Lac is one of these partner universities.

UW-Madison Connections is a dual admission program to the University of Wisconsin- Madison and to the University of Wisconsin-Fond du Lac. UW-Madison offers this program to a select group of UW-Madison freshman applicants. The program allows Wisconsin residents to start at UW-Fond du Lac and complete their bachelor's degree at UW-Madison. Students are dually admitted to UW-Madison and UW-Fond du Lac.

How a student benefits

A UW-Madison Connections student receives a UW-Madison ID granting many of the same privileges as other UW-Madison students, including:

  • access to UW-Madison libraries
  • access to recreational facilities
  • a UW-Madison email account through the My UW-Madison Web portal access to cultural and social events offered at the university
  • ability to purchase UW-Madison athletic tickets at student rates
